Since 2011, the US Department of Agriculture’s Centre for Nutrition Policy and Promotion has revealed its MyPlate information, whereas the federal government in Brazil has centered on the Nova system developed by the University of São Paulo, which classifies meals into 4 classes relying on their degree of processing. Although it’s properly revered, up to now the widespread adoption of the Nova system has been hampered by the very fact that it depends on handbook labelling of merchandise. Now in bid to handle this drawback, a bunch of America physics and medical researchers have developed a machine learning resolution, FoodProX, which they lately introduced within the journal Nature Communications.

Four food classes
FoodProx relies on the identical classification as Nova, which American researchers have argued doesn’t embody adequate listed knowledge. The Nova system divides food into 4 classes (Nova 1 to 4): pure or marginally processed (lower, floor, dried, and so forth.) meals, processed culinary elements (oil, salt, lump sugar, butter), merchandise combining meals from the 2 first classes and merchandise that have been processed to increase their shelf life (canned meals, cheese, fruit in syrup), and eventually, ultra-processed meals (truffles, industrial bread, sauces, pizzas, breakfast cereals, snacks, scorching canine, and so forth.). As the analysis paper explains, these are “industrial formulations sometimes of 5 or extra elements together with substances not generally utilized in culinary preparations, resembling components whose objective is to mimic sensory qualities of contemporary food.” For its half, FoodProX has been skilled on dietary measures for 2484 meals listed within the Food and Nutrient Database for Dietary Studies, a repository maintained by the US Department of Agriculture, which compiles public survey knowledge on Americans’ diets. Each of the meals within the database comprises between 65 and 102 vitamins.
A chance score of 0 to 1 for every food class
Based on its coaching, FoodProX has the power to analyse the record of vitamins for any food product and to foretell its degree of processing. More exactly the classifier generates 4 chance rankings between 0 and 1 for every of the 4 food classes within the Nova system earlier than figuring out the product as a member of the class for which it has the very best score. For instance, FoodProX predicts that uncooked onion has a 0.97 chance of belonging to the primary “pure meals” class, and a 0.01 to 0.03 chance that it’s a member of one of many others. Thus, uncooked onion is deemed to belong to the primary class, whereas battered and fried onion rings, which obtain a score of 0.99 for the fourth class, are deemed to be ultra-processed.
In the later phases of its improvement, FoodProX was additional examined on the dietary composition of 100-gram parts of meals listed in one other database of Branded Food Products, earlier than being as soon as once more tuned on a Food and Drugs Administration corpus, which particulars the vitamins in 12 grams of every food product. Thereafter, FoodProX was used to categorise the entire food merchandise that had but to be included within the Nova system. It discovered that over 73.35% of food eaten by Americans is ultra-processed and fewer than 20% is made up of pure or minimally processed merchandise.
A tool for customers and resolution makers
“First as a person you need to use this tool to establish meals you already eat that are extremely processed and seek for much less processed options,” explains Albert-László Barabási, a co-author of the examine and an information science specialist on the Central European University in Budapest (Hungary) and Harvard Medical School. With this in thoughts, the analysis staff has created the TrueFood web site to allow customers to verify the standing of numerous food merchandise offered within the US, that are listed by model and by retailer. On a extra political degree, TrueFood can even function decision-making tool for public authorities and organizations liable for public well being. “On the extent of presidency, these instruments can be utilized to establish closely processed meals, and to facilitate motion to scale back their consumption utilizing a wider vary of devices, from instructional campaigns to tax coverage.”
